Ingredients

For this Keto stuffed pepper soup, you will need the following ingredients:

Base Ingredients

  • Olive oil: 1 TBS
  • Onion chopped: 70 g/2.5 oz
  • Ground beef: 450 g/1 lb/16 oz
  • Green or yellow pepper chopped: 80 g/2.8 oz
  • Red pepper chopped: 145 g/5.12 oz
  • Minced garlic: 3 cloves

Liquids & Seasonings

  • Canned crushed tomato: 1 cup/200 ml
  • Beef broth: 1.5 cup/300 ml
  • Water: 2 cups/400 ml
  • Salt: 1/2 teaspoon or more to taste
  • Pepper: to taste
  • Ground paprika: 1 tsp
  • Turmeric: 1 tsp
  • Dried basil: 1 tsp
  • Dried oregano: 1 tsp

Fresh Garnishes

  • Freshly chopped parsley: 1 TBS

FOR SERVING

  • Sour cream
  • Freshly chopped parsley
  • Spring onion chopped
  • Shredded cheddar cheese

How to Make Keto stuffed pepper soup

Step 1: Sauté the Aromatics

In a large pot, heat 1 TBS of olive oil over medium heat. Once hot, add the chopped onion. Stir occasionally until the onion turns golden brown and caramelized.

Step 2: Brown the Beef

Add the ground beef to the pot with the caramelized onions. Stir regularly until it’s browned thoroughly.

Step 3: Add Vegetables

Incorporate the chopped green or yellow pepper along with minced garlic into the mix. Stir for a few minutes until fragrant.

Step 4: Combine Liquids and Spices

Pour in the canned crushed tomatoes, beef broth, water, salt, pepper, paprika, turmeric, basil, and oregano (everything except fresh parsley). Stir well.

Step 5: Simmer

Bring the mixture to a boil. Once boiling, cover the pot and reduce heat to medium. Let it cook for about 20 minutes.

Step 6: Final Touches

After simmering for 20 minutes, taste your soup. Adjust seasoning if needed by adding more salt. Cook uncovered for an additional 5 to 10 minutes before stirring in freshly chopped parsley.

Step 7: Serve Hot

Ladle the soup into bowls and top with additional freshly chopped parsley, spring onion, sour cream, or shredded cheddar cheese as desired.

Enjoy your comforting bowl of Keto stuffed pepper soup!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Avoiding common mistakes can significantly improve your cooking experience and the final taste of your Keto stuffed pepper soup.

  • Skipping the caramelization: Failing to caramelize the onion properly can lead to a less flavorful base. Take the time to let it brown for the best flavor.
  • Overcooking the beef: Cooking ground beef too long can dry it out. Stir it occasionally until it’s browned, then move on to adding other ingredients.
  • Ignoring seasoning adjustments: Not tasting and adjusting salt and spices during cooking can affect the flavor. Always taste before serving and adjust as needed.
  • Using low-quality broth: A poor-quality broth can make your soup lack depth. Use a good quality beef broth for richer flavor.
  • Not letting it simmer long enough: Rushing through the simmering process can prevent flavors from fully developing. Allow it to simmer for at least 20 minutes.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store in an airtight container for up to 3-4 days.
  • Allow soup to cool completely before sealing.

Freezing Keto stuffed pepper soup

  • Freeze in airtight containers or freezer-safe bags for up to 2-3 months.
  • Leave some space in containers as the soup may expand when frozen.

Reheating Keto stuffed pepper soup

  •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and heat in an oven-safe container until warm throughout.
  • Microwave: Place in a microwave-safe dish, cover loosely, and heat in short intervals, stirring between, until hot.
  • Stovetop: Heat gently over medium heat, stirring occasionally until heated through.
